Unlock Expert Strategies in Oracle GoldenGate 12c: Troubleshooting and Tuning Ed 1

Download Course Contents

Oracle GoldenGate 12c: Troubleshooting and Tuning Ed 1 Course Overview


Oracle GoldenGate 12c: Troubleshooting and Tuning Ed 1 is a comprehensive course designed to provide experienced Oracle GoldenGate 12c administrators, developers, and users with a complete understanding of the troubleshooting, diagnostics, and tuning topics related to Oracle GoldenGate 12c.
The course covers topics ranging from an overview of Oracle GoldenGate 12c’s architecture to performance-tuning scenarios. It also introduces various techniques, tools, and techniques for diagnosing and troubleshooting Oracle GoldenGate 12c.
The course is designed to equip Oracle GoldenGate 12c administrators, developers, and users with the knowledge needed for completing successful Oracle GoldenGate 12c implementations. It also covers how to test and configure Oracle GoldenGate 12c for performance-tuning and troubleshooting.
At the end of the course, learners should be able to:
• Understand the architecture of Oracle GoldenGate 12c
• Use key tools and techniques to diagnose and troubleshoot Oracle GoldenGate 12c
• Test and configure Oracle GoldenGate 12c for performance-tuning
• Troubleshoot replication errors and build performance-tuning solution

This is a Rare Course and it can be take up to 3 weeks to arrange the training.

home-icon

The 1-on-1 Advantage

Get 1-on-1 session with our expert trainers at a date & time of your convenience.
home-icon

Flexible Dates

Start your session at a date of your choice-weekend & evening slots included, and reschedule if necessary.
home-icon

4-Hour Sessions

Training never been so convenient- attend training sessions 4-hour long for easy learning.
home-icon

Destination Training

Attend trainings at some of the most loved cities such as Dubai, London, Delhi(India), Goa, Singapore, New York and Sydney.

You will learn:

Module 1: Gathering Evidence
  • Acquiring confidence using the standard Oracle GoldenGate tools normally used to interact with the software:
  • GGSCI
  • Error Logs, Process Reports, Discard File, System Logs
  • Competently using the tools mentioned above to gather evidence about alleged issues occurring to an Oracle GoldenGate envir
  • Accessing knowledge Documents - Mailing lists, Oracle GoldenGate forums, etc
  • Consulting the Documentation
  • Getting familiar with the ShowSyntax parameter
  • Getting familiar with the logdump utility
  • Getting familiar with basic problems
  • Developing the ability to deal with Extract and Replicat startup issues
  • Verifying file names, file permissions, consistency between Extract and Replicat group names and their supporting files
  • Verifying consistent naming convention when defining trail files and their reference in the Extract/Replicat parameter files
  • Verifying that the correct software version has been installed
  • Verifying that the Oracle GoldenGate manager is running, that the group name which fails to start exists and is not misspelt
  • Verifying that the the parameter file exists, has the same name as the Extract/Replicat group, and is accessible by Oracle Golde
  • Introducing the use of CHECKPARAMS to verify that the parameter syntax is correct
  • Developing the ability to deal with and troubleshoot data extraction issues:Extract is slow - Extract abends - Data pump abends
  • Analyzing various causes of a slow Extract startup
  • Tracing may be enabled, activity logging may be enabled, many columns listed in tables being replicated
  • Introducing the use of the CacheMgr parameter to control the virtual memory and temporary disk space that are available for cac
  • In-depth analysis of abending Extracts: is Extract unable to open the transaction logs? - Checking to see if the disk is full -Is an a
  • In-depth analysis of abending data pumps: Does the data pump abend with error number 509 ("Incompatible record")?Have th
  • Was the primary Extract or the data pump stopped, re-added, or restarted without resetting the data pump’s read position in the
  • Developing the ability to deal with and troubleshoot data replication issues:
  • Analyzing the various causes of a "stuck" Replicat: Does "Stats Replicat" return no statistics? Do successive "Info Replicat" com
  • Verifying that the Replicat is reading the trail to which Extract is writing
  • Analyzing the reasons why a Replicat abends: Is Replicat unable to locate a trail? Is Replicat unable to open a trail file? Was "Ad
  • Developing the ability to deal with and troubleshoot missed transactions involving issues such as: Tables that are not properly s
  • Analyzing the reasons why transactions are not being processed: Were the tables included in Table and Map statements? Are f
  • Single quotes' on object names imply case-sensitive names for some databases (including the Oracle database)
  • Are the transactions coming out of the source system properly?
  • Developing the ability to deal with and troubleshoot mapping problems, such us: Fetching from the source data fails - Table and
  • Analyzing the causes of various mapping problems:Is Extract returning fetch-related errors? Was the row containing the da
  • Has the undo retention expired?
  • Is "NoUseLatestVersion" for "FetchOptions" being used?
  • Do the source and target tables exist in the databases? Are they specified correctly in the Table or Map statement? Are their na
  • Do table and column names contain only supported characters?
  • Are WHERE clauses comparing different data types?
  • Is KeyCols being used? Are both source and target KeyCols being used? Corresponding source and target columns must match
  • Developing the ability to deal with and troubleshoot:
  • SQLEXEC problems - File-maintenance problems - Time differences - Too many open cursors
  • File-Maintenance Problems: Discard File Is Not Created - Discard File Is Too Big - Trail File Is Too Big
  • Miscellaneous Problems: Time Differences - INFO Command Shows Incorrect Status
  • Identifying causes of slow startups
  • Monitoring lag and statistics
  • Tuning Manager
  • Identifying network and disk bottlenecks
  • Tuning "Classic" Extract
  • Tuning "Classic" Replicat
  • Describing architecture and advantages of the new Integrated capture
  • Describing architecture and advantages of the new Integrated delivery
  • Familiarizing with the new V$ tables holding real time Oracle GoldenGate statistics
  • Familiarizing with Troubleshooting Aids and Tools for Integrated Replication
  • Describing Oracle GoldenGate Healthcheck for Integrated Replicat
  • Describing the Oracle Database 12c GoldenGate AWR report
Live Online Training (Duration : 32 Hours) Fee On Request
We Offer :
  • 1-on-1 Public - Select your own start date. Other students can be merged.
  • 1-on-1 Private - Select your own start date. You will be the only student in the class.

4 Hours
8 Hours
Week Days
Weekend

Start Time : At any time

12 AM
12 PM

1-On-1 Training is Guaranteed to Run (GTR)
Group Training
Date On Request
Course Prerequisites

This Oracle GoldenGate 12c: Troubleshooting and Tuning Ed 1 Training course is intended for administrators and engineers responsible for managing Oracle GoldenGate 12c implementations. Candidates should have a comprehensive knowledge of and experience in installing, configuring, and managing Oracle GoldenGate 12c (2020.1) in an Oracle Database on-premise and cloud environment. This course requires that each attendee have completed the following prerequisites:
• Installation and Configuration of Oracle GoldenGate 12c: Ed 1 Training
• Working knowledge of Oracle Database concepts
• Basic knowledge of UNIX/Linux commands
• Understanding of Oracle Database replication concepts and architecture

Target Audience


The primary target audience for Oracle GoldenGate 12c: Troubleshooting and Tuning Ed 1 training are architects and senior DBAs with experience in administering Oracle GoldenGate
It is a must-have for any advanced user, as it offers deep-level instruction for a variety of diagnostics and optimizations, granting an understanding of best practices for identifying and resolving a variety of replication problems
This course is ideal for participants already familiar with setting up and managing Oracle GoldenGate 12c and want to advance their knowledge into more complex areas
It is designed for those with old and newer experience in administration, software support and consulting

Learning Objectives of Oracle GoldenGate 12c: Troubleshooting and Tuning Ed 1


1. Understand the architecture of Oracle GoldenGate 12c and create setup for data replication.
2. Be able to administer and troubleshoot Oracle GoldenGate 12c.
3. Upgrade older versions of Oracle GoldenGate to 12c.
4. Automate the installation and configuration of Oracle GoldenGate 12c.
5. Perform performance tuning of Oracle GoldenGate 12c.
6. Learn how to set up real-time Data Replication from a variety of sources.
7. Manage replication process, troubleshoot errors and optimize system performance.
8. Use GoldenGate monitoring tools to monitor and analyze replication.
9. Use Oracle GoldenGate security features for enhanced data protection.
10. Understand and use Advanced Compression, Parallel Replicat, custom compression and encryption.

FAQ's


1-on-1 Public - Select your start date. Other students can be merged.
1-on-1 Private - Select your start date. You will be the only student in the class.
Yes, course requiring practical include hands-on labs.
You can buy online from the page by clicking on "Buy Now". You can view alternate payment method on payment options page.
Yes, you can pay from the course page and flexi page.
Yes, the site is secure by utilizing Secure Sockets Layer (SSL) Technology. SSL technology enables the encryption of sensitive information during online transactions. We use the highest assurance SSL/TLS certificate, which ensures that no unauthorized person can get to your sensitive payment data over the web.
We use the best standards in Internet security. Any data retained is not shared with third parties.
You can request a refund if you do not wish to enroll in the course.
To receive an acknowledgment of your online payment, you should have a valid email address. At the point when you enter your name, Visa, and other data, you have the option of entering your email address. Would it be a good idea for you to decide to enter your email address, confirmation of your payment will be emailed to you.
After you submit your payment, you will land on the payment confirmation screen.It contains your payment confirmation message. You will likewise get a confirmation email after your transaction is submitted.
We do accept all major credit cards from Visa, Mastercard, American Express, and Discover.
Credit card transactions normally take 48 hours to settle. Approval is given right away; however,it takes 48 hours for the money to be moved.
Yes, we do accept partial payments, you may use one payment method for part of the transaction and another payment method for other parts of the transaction.
Yes, if we have an office in your city.
Yes, we do offer corporate training More details
Yes, we do.
Yes, we also offer weekend classes.
Yes, Koenig follows a BYOL(Bring Your Own Laptop) policy.
It is recommended but not mandatory. Being acquainted with the basic course material will enable you and the trainer to move at a desired pace during classes.You can access courseware for most vendors.
Yes, this is our official email address which we use if a recipient is not able to receive emails from our @koenig-solutions.com email address.
Buy-Now. Pay-Later option is available using credit card in USA and India only.
You will receive the letter of course attendance post training completion via learning enhancement tool after registration.
Yes you can.
Yes, we do. For details go to flexi
You can pay through debit/credit card or bank wire transfer.
Yes you can request your customer experience manager for the same.
Yes, fee excludes local taxes.
Yes, we do.
Yes, Koenig Solutions is a Oracle Learning Partner
Schedule for Group Training is decided by Koenig. Schedule for 1-on-1 is decided by you.
In 1 on 1 Public you can select your own schedule, other students can be merged. Choose 1-on-1 if published schedule doesn't meet your requirement. If you want a private session, opt for 1-on-1 Private.
Duration of Ultra-Fast Track is 50% of the duration of the Standard Track. Yes(course content is same).

Prices & Payments

Yes of course.
Yes, We are

Travel and Visa

Yes we do after your registration for course.

Food and Beverages

Yes.

Others

Says our CEO-
“It is an interesting story and dates back half a century. My father started a manufacturing business in India in the 1960's for import substitute electromechanical components such as microswitches. German and Japanese goods were held in high esteem so he named his company Essen Deinki (Essen is a well known industrial town in Germany and Deinki is Japanese for electric company). His products were very good quality and the fact that they sounded German and Japanese also helped. He did quite well. In 1970s he branched out into electronic products and again looked for a German name. This time he chose Koenig, and Koenig Electronics was born. In 1990s after graduating from college I was looking for a name for my company and Koenig Solutions sounded just right. Initially we had marketed under the brand of Digital Equipment Corporation but DEC went out of business and we switched to the Koenig name. Koenig is difficult to pronounce and marketeers said it is not a good choice for a B2C brand. But it has proven lucky for us.” – Says Rohit Aggarwal (Founder and CEO - Koenig Solutions)
All our trainers are fluent in English . Majority of our customers are from outside India and our trainers speak in a neutral accent which is easily understandable by students from all nationalities. Our money back guarantee also stands for accent of the trainer.
Medical services in India are at par with the world and are a fraction of costs in Europe and USA. A number of our students have scheduled cosmetic, dental and ocular procedures during their stay in India. We can provide advice about this, on request.
Yes, if you send 4 participants, we can offer an exclusive training for them which can be started from Any Date™ suitable for you.